Hot news about the next Lexus LS



Dear 001,

Check out what I just read in the new Road and Track...

Lexus still has plenty of surprises up its sleeve, one of which is the LS 600h. Based on the LS 430, Lexus' popular luxury sedan, this super luxo hybrid will feature the company's future 4.6-liter V-8 coupled with an electric motor. Rumors say the car will produce about 500 bhp (400 from the engine and 100 from the motor), making it one of the most powerful full-size luxury sedans in the marketplace.

Lexus plans to upgrade both its sporty and environmentally sensitive image at the same time. Therefore, the big-bhp LS makes sense. It will have the performance of others in the category, going head-to-head with cars such as the Mercedes-Benz S65 AMG. But the Lexus has the added environmentalist cachet of being a hybrid.
